How is your life different than it would have been if you never received the transfer?
The greatest different in my life ever since Give Directly came into my life. I now have my own home where I can do my projects and even live happily with my family. I finally managed to move away from my parents' homestead. I feel independent which is a great achievement since no one in my village knew I would one day own a home. Apart from that I also bought food that lasted for a couple of days. I also planted some food crops that have also sustained us for a while. I can't thank this organization enough, I will continue praying for them so that they get more blessings and continue helping other people.
In your opinion, what does GiveDirectly do well, and what does it not do well?
In my opinion, I believe that whatever they did in our village is historic. It transformed the face of our village tremendously. People built houses, took their children to school and bought livestock. The mode of operation is unique and it would be better if other institutions would emulate their projects and how they implement them.
What did you spend your second transfer on?
I spent the large portion of the second transfer that I received from Give Directly to build a new house. The one I use to live in was within my parents' homestead. I chose to build mine separately because I felt it was my greatest moment to implement what I was yearning for a while. I also bought some clothes for my children and used the remaining amount to buy food for my family. I am a single parent and receiving this help means a lot to me. I can't thank Give Directly enough for choosing me as one of their beneficiaries.

Describe the biggest difference in your daily life.
The biggest difference in my daily life is happiness and stress-free life since I have been able to clear school fees for my child.
Describe the moment when you received your money. How did you feel?
I was filled with much happiness the moment I received money from GiveDirectly.
What did you spend your first transfer on?
I spent my first transfer to build a house for my family and used the remaining 6000 KES to pay school fees for my child.

What does receiving this money mean to you?
Receiving this money means that i will be able to pay school fees for my child in Secondary school with ease as well as buy dairy cattle in my farm.
What is the happiest part of your day?
The happiest part of my day is in the evening. This is the time my children arrive from school and i usually thank God that the day went on well without them being sent home for school fees.
What is the biggest hardship you've faced in your life?
The biggest hardship i have faced in my life the struggle i go through in paying school fees for my four children, now that I am a single mother and getting a source of income is a great challenge. This forces me to engage in hard casual jobs like quarrying which affects my health.
